recessed

Example

The recessed lighting in the kitchen creates a warm and inviting atmosphere. [recessed: adjective]

Example

The shelves were recessed into the wall to save space. [recessed: verb]

retracted

Example

The cat retracted its claws after playfully swatting at the toy. [retracted: verb]

Example

The newspaper retracted its earlier report, admitting it was based on false information. [retracted: verb]

Which word is more common?

Recessed is more common than retracted in everyday language, especially in the context of architecture and design. Retracted is more specialized and is typically used in technical or scientific contexts.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between recessed and retracted?

Both recessed and retracted can be used in formal or technical contexts, but retracted may have a negative connotation if used to describe a retraction of a statement or claim.
